    • Kualoa Ranch: This iconic ranch is a short drive from Kaneohe Bay and offers incredible outdoor adventures. You can take a Hollywood movie site tour, explore the lush valleys on an ATV, or go horseback riding. The ranch has been the filming location for numerous movies and TV shows, making it a fun experience. This is a must-see.     • Byodo-In Temple: This stunning Buddhist temple is a hidden gem located in the Valley of the Temples. It's a serene and beautiful place to visit, offering a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le. The temple is a replica of a 1,000-year-old temple in Japan. It features a large Buddha statue, koi ponds, and lush gardens. This tranquil spot provides a perfect spot for reflection and relaxation, as well as an ideal photo opportunity.
